概括
研究人员将人类神经元集成到计算机中,创造了DishBrain,一种学会打pong的生物智能. 这一进步引发了人们对人工痛苦和合成现象学的伦理担忧.

背景情况:
- 人类和人工智能的融合是一个日益增长的研究领域.
- 辩论通常集中在脑-计算机接口上,但一种补充方法涉及将生物神经元集成到数字系统中.
研究的目的:
- 讨论将体外人类神经网络集成到型计算环境中的伦理影响.
- 用一个案例研究来分析生物智能的创造.
主要方法:
- 利用了一种叫做DishBrain的系统,它将干细胞衍生的人类神经元嵌入多电极阵列中的虚拟游戏环境中.
- 神经集群从游戏中接收电输入,并产生输出信号来控制行动.
主要成果:
- DishBrain成功地学会了玩电脑游戏"Pong".
- 该系统在虚拟环境中表现出自我组织和智能行为.
- 证明了生物智能的潜力.
结论:
- 创建混合生物智能带来了重大的伦理挑战.
- 潜在的风险包括创造合成现象学和人工痛苦.
- 对于开发合成生物智能,建议采取谨慎的方法.

The Stereotype Content Model (SCM) was first proposed by Susan Fiske and her colleagues (Fiske, Cuddy, Glick & Xu, 2002; see also Fiske, 2012 and Fiske, 2017). The SCM specifies that when someone encounters a new group, they will stereotype them based on two metrics: warmth—or that group’s perceived intent, and how likely they are to provide help or inflict harm—and competence—or their ability to carry out that objective.
